I will however tell you how I did it so you can create your own.
I narrowed the list of possible tours down to five or so. I used only the main tour operators that received positive reviews. Across the top of the chart were the names of the five tours, along with the appropriate tour operator. I had a bunch of rows set up so I could enter the tour info. Based on their websites, I typed in (or maybe I copied and pasted...) the tour info -- one cell for each stop on the tour. I also entered other relevant info -- prices, for instance -- into the cells.
I printed it out, and highlighted the parts that were common to all five tours. What was left -- the unhighlighted parts -- showed the differences. From there I was able to make a decision.

For what it's worth, if any of you are interested in doing your own, here's how I did it:
- narrow down your choices to 3 or 4 possibilities
- set up a chart with a column for each plus a column at the start for each possible stop on the tour
- for each possible stop, fill in the appropriate tour column with Y or N or write in details such as early admission
When I set up the chart I didn't worry about what order we did things in -- my priority was having a solid footing to be able to make content comparisons.
